Last night, while playing for Farmington High School, senior goaltender Austin Krause left the rink in spectacular fashion. He scored a deliberate own-goal, flipped off his coaches and then saluted the crowd before skating off to the dressing room…

His team was 1-0 up, but Krause’s own-goal levelled things to 1-1. With three minutes left on the clock Farmington HS were forced to bring on their third string goalie (their first choice was injured) and to the surprise of absolutely no-one the opposing team, Chaska High School, scored the game’s winning goal.

Apparently the whole ordeal was over Krause, a senior, playing second string to the injured first choice who is a sophomore. One thing is for sure; Krause’s high school hockey days are well and truly over.
